As early as in 1950, Robert Favre Le Bret, Executive Director of the Festival de Cannes, suggested including a film market in the Festival de Cannes, but his idea was rejected because the festival committee stressed out artistic significance and values of the Cannes festival and didn’t want to clutter it with commerce. For a whole decade, le Festival de la rue d'Antibes ran in parallel with the Cannes Film Festival, sometimes coinciding with important events. Seeing the success of the film market, the Cannes Film Festival Committee finally agreed to include it in its programme. In 1980, L'Association du Festival ("the festival association") decided to establish the Secrétariat Général du Marché du Film ("General Secretariat of the film market"), with Michel Bonnet and Marcel Lathière in charge. They started to slowly set up the Marché du Film by introducing fares for films

Launched 15 years ago, the Producers Network hosts producers from all around the world for a series of meetings and unique events specifically designed to create opportunities to build peer networks and get international co-production projects off the ground.

A number of programs are provided during the Marché du Film for the benefit of producers, directors, festival programmers, sales agents, and other film industry professionals:

In 2012, more than half of the screenings were in European countries, with a total of 4,000 films sold at the Marché du Film that year, half of which were fully completed.

Goes to Cannes spotlights work-in-progress projects looking for sales agents, distributors or festival selection.
